SEATTLE — An Amtrak train caught fire in a SoDo yard rail Friday morning.

The Amtrak rail yard is on South Holgate Street at Third Avenue South in Seattle.

All westbound lanes of Holgate were blocked for the fire response but have since reopened.

The fire is now out.  No one was inside the train when the fire broke out, and no one was hurt.

According to Seattle Fire, the flames started inside a compartment  just before 4 a.m. as the train was being refueled.
